Hypertable has stopped its further development with March 2016 and is removed from the DB-Engines ranking.
DescriptionA MySQL compatible DBMS with Git-like versioning of data and schemaCloud-hosted realtime document store. iOS, Android, and JavaScript clients share one Realtime Database instance and automatically receive updates with the newest data.An open source BigTable implementation based on distributed file systems such as HadoopA robust multi-value DBMS comprising development tools and middleware
Primary database modelRelational DBMSDocument storeWide column storeMultivalue DBMS
